Tim here.  In addition to the other replies on the list, I've found
PDF-to-X converters useful, whether that's pdftotext to convert them
to plain-text, or pdftohtml to create HTML (it's not the best HTML)
and then view that in the browser (including lynx or other CLI
browsers)
